Back to Basics with Underwear and Music

Underwear and Music

Extract from newspaper, 2011

Yes, music and underpants will today be the main agenda at the International Women’s Day Centenary Celebration at the Mathare Outreach Community Centre in Nairobi from11.30am to 2pm.

The theme of the celebration is Change Begins with Basics and will include music and poetry to inspire the children at the community centre, to recognise their potential and raise their aspirations.

This campaign was started a month ago as a private initiative called Panties with Purpose, launched by Maridadi.co.ke, and it aims to support 6,000 girls in 32 schools across Kenya with panties and sanitary pads.

According to UNICEF (2007) 1 in 10 school-age poor girls in rural areas do not attend school during their menstruation because of lack of access to underwear and sanitary towels. Consequently, a girl in high school (four years) loses 156 learning days, which is equivalent to almost 24 weeks out of 144 weeks of school time. There is no immediate short-term solution to this problem and every month more girls continue to be compromised – their dignity, health, confidence and success rate at school suffers.
